Main duties of the job
This post holder is expected to co-ordinate and monitor the full administrative service for the therapy teams, under the guidance of the administrative lead. At times you will be expected to step into the administrator lead role, in order to provide cover during staff shortage and to support your team.
You will be the first point of contact for the admin team with any queries and for support with demanding or unhappy patients. You will also be expected to ensure that clinics are effectively managed and appointments are utilised effectively to contribute to the management of waiting lists.
You will provide supervision for the administration team, undertaking regular one to one meetings and annual achievement reviews. You will also be involved in service development and the updating and maintenance of efficient processes for the admin team and ensuring accurate collection and recording of data.
